Council Variance Application:  CV03-035
 
APPLICANT:  Worthington Office Park, LLC; c/o John P. Kennedy, Atty.; 500 South Front Street, Suite 1200; Columbus, Ohio 43215.
 
PROPOSED USE: Office/warehouse, commercial and storage.
                                                                                
CITY DEPARTMENTS' RECOMMENDATION:  Approval.  The applicants have received a recommendation of approval for a concurrent rezoning (Z03-013), from R, Rural District to the L-M, Limited Manufacturing District.  The applicants are requesting variances to reduce maneuvering, a parking setback and the number of parking spaces required.  These variances have been approval by the Transportation Division.

WHEREAS, by application #CV03-035 the owner of property at 211 OAK STREET (43235), is requesting a Council Variance in conjunction with a rezoning request (Z03-013) to reduce parking and maneuvering standards for an office/commercial/storage development; and
 
WHEREAS, Section 3342.15, Maneuvering, requires every parking space to have sufficient access and maneuvering area which may include an aisle, circulation area or improved alley, while the applicant proposes to allow maneuvering within the existing setback for seventeen (17) parking spaces; and
 
WHEREAS, Section 3342.18, Parking setback line, requires that parking be set back ten (10) feet from Oak Street; while the applicant proposes to provide a zero (0) foot setback along Oak Street; and   
 
WHEREAS, Section 3342.28(A) and (B), Minimum number of parking spaces required, requires at total of fifty-four (54) parking spaces, while the applicant proposes to provide a total of forty-six (46) parking spaces; and
 
WHEREAS, City Departments note a hardship exists and recommend approval because the applicants have received a recommendation of approval for a concurrent rezoning (Z03-013), from R, Rural District to the L-M, Limited Manufacturing Districtand the applicants have received approval from the Transportation Division for the proposed variances; and  
 
WHEREAS, said ordinance requires separate submission for all applicable permits and Certificate of Occupancy for the proposed use; and
 
WHEREAS, said variance will not adversely affect the surrounding property or surrounding neighborhood; and
 
WHEREAS, the granting of said variance will not impair an adequate supply of light and air to adjacent properties or unreasonably increase the congestion of public streets, or unreasonably diminish or impair established property values within the surrounding area, or otherwise impair the public health, safety, comfort, morals, or welfare of the inhabitants of the City of Columbus; and
  
WHEREAS, the granting of said variance will alleviate the difficulties encountered by the owners of the property located at 211 OAK STREET (43235), in using said property as desired; now, therefore:
